Smart mine refers to the use of artificial intelligence 、 Modern technologies such as industrial Internet information technology and automatic control are used to develop and utilize coal mines , Make each system fully integrated , Be able to fully perceive , Including the ability to learn autonomously and adaptively , Realize the development of the whole coal mine 、 Mining 、 ventilation 、 Wash 、 Safety guarantee 、 Complete intellectualization of all links of transportation 、 Automatic operation .

At this stage , The digital transformation of the coal industry has not yet formed an overall and life-cycle application management . Smart mines are still facing a lack of theoretical support 、 Lack of systematic planning 、 Challenges such as high technical risks . Overview of mine resources
Loading and displaying the point layer of enterprise mine geographical distribution based on 3D map , It supports running in and loading to display the 3D model of the mine , Integrate and converge mine resources 、 Production, sales and inventory 、 Production status 、 Real time data such as coal mining excavation , Combined with real-time production monitoring video , The three-dimensional panorama shows the production and operation status of the enterprise mine , Assist the production dispatching command center to control the production and operation situation of the mine in real time .
Safety monitoring
Based on the twin platform of 3D reality , For safety supervision production personnel 、 equipment 、 vehicle 、 Location of monitoring points and other elements 、 Real time monitoring of status and other information , Combined with artificial intelligence 、 Intelligent sensing technologies such as the Internet of things , Environmental situation ( Dust 、 Gas 、 water 、 Harmful gases )、 Staff working situation 、 Equipment operation and maintenance 、 Real time monitoring of production progress and other information , For all kinds of abnormal situations ( Personnel intrusion 、 Illegal operation identification alarm 、 Disaster warning, etc ) Carry out real-time warning ; And based on professional model algorithm , Tunneling 、 Exploitation 、 Key data indicators of transportation and other business links , And major disaster monitoring 、 Equipment safety analysis 、 Environmental safety monitoring 、 Visual analysis of a number of core data such as human and vehicle safety analysis , Realization “ people 、 The earth 、 matter 、 things ” Intelligent association analysis of multi-source data , To provide comprehensive decision-making for users 、 Objective data support and basis .

Emergency command
Based on the warning prompt of security events , Start emergency disposal , The system automatically correlates and locates the location of mine events and related equipment , The association shows the emergency command group 、 Disposal plan 、 Surrounding resources 、 Surrounding videos and other information , Combined with video consultation system , Achieve rapid positioning of emergencies 、 Remote verification 、 video conferencing 、 Resource scheduling 、 Panoramic visual command and dispatching for rapid disposal , Improve the work efficiency of the production dispatching command center for emergency disposal of safety events .

Intelligent inspection
Integrate the system data of mine inspection department , Combined with video intelligent analysis 、 Intelligent positioning 、 Intelligent research and judgment technology , Based on GIS , For patrol inspection equipment 、 robot 、 personnel 、 Location of elements such as alarm events 、 type 、 Visually display information such as status ; Support Click to query the surrounding monitoring video of abnormal points 、 Event details 、 The handler 、 Work order carrying capacity 、 Work order progress 、 Estimated completion time and other details ; At the same time, it can be based on professional model algorithm , Inspect the work order 、 Patrol problem 、 Multi dimensional visual analysis of core data such as equipment problems , Provide managers with real-time inspection reports and scientific decision-making basis .
